Stripping off the fairing is never a neutral choice. With the FZ8, Yamaha decided to expose the 779cc inline four-cylinder without filters, betting everything on a direct connection between rider and engine. The die-cast aluminium diamond frame with the engine as a stressed member, the 43mm upside-down fork and the monobloc calipers inherited from the FZ1 build a sports-grade chassis in a naked format that proves effective both on tight winding roads and in everyday use. The stock muffler, compact and laterally positioned, has long been considered one of the bike's aesthetic weak points by many owners: something our sports exhausts address with a targeted upgrade. The products in this category are sports exhausts designed to replace the original muffler on the FZ8. The work concerns the final silencer only: the original headers and the front section of the exhaust system remain in place. Fitting is carried out on the bike's original mounting points with no special adapters required, and each exhaust is supplied with a complete fitting kit. To ensure a proper seal and correct alignment, we recommend having the installation carried out by a qualified mechanic.
The weight saving over the stock muffler is tangible and noticeable across the whole bike. In terms of sound, the FZ8's four-cylinder — already full-voiced in standard form — gains a more defined and characterful note with a sports exhaust, with a richer tone at mid and high revs. On a naked bike, the change in acoustic character is particularly noticeable, with no fairing acting as a sound barrier between rider and engine. In terms of behaviour, a different management of exhaust gas flow can favour a more linear throttle response and, in certain riding conditions, a greater feeling of engine readiness.
Two sleeve lengths are available for this category: 285 mm and 400 mm. The difference is primarily aesthetic and relates to lateral bulk, allowing you to find the visual proportions that best suit your bike. Both versions of the sports exhausts share the same construction characteristics and the same lateral positioning.

Every sports exhaust is supplied with a standard dB killer included. Our exhausts are homologated for road use throughout Europe and Switzerland: the homologation certificate is included and is valid with the dB killer fitted. Removing the dB killer invalidates the product's homologation. For those who want to reduce the sound level further, the No-Noise option is available, with an internally welded filter that provides a perceptible reduction in decibels without significantly affecting the exhaust's overall behaviour. The selection is made directly on the product page.
As this involves replacing only the end can on a fuel-injected bike like the FZ8, no ECU remapping or modifications to the engine management are normally required. The engine management adapts to the new configuration without any particular electronic issues.
